Smallest computer chip developed
REUTERS
WASHINGTON, JULY 17: The possibility of building computers no bigger than a grain of sand but billions of times faster than existing machines is a little closer to reality, according to an article published in the journal Science. Researchers at the University of California at Los Angeles and Hewlett-Packard created a computer switch called "Logic Gate" that is only one molecule thick. The scientists said in the article in yesterday's issue of the journal that this advance opens up new possibilities for making computer chips billions of times smaller and faster than existing ones."Very small machines containing vast amounts of resources... may be possible, yet their basic operating and programming principles will be essentially the same as for present systems," they wrote.
